Analysis

The most recent figure for external debt stocks, short-term (dod, current us$), per capita in Kazakhstan is 951.53 DOD, current US$ per person,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.2% on the previous year and up 73.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, external debt stocks, short-term (dod, current us$), per capita in Kazakhstan peaked at 953.03 DOD, current US$ per person in 2023 and was at its lowest, 0.5325 DOD, current US$ per person, in 1992.

Kazakhstan ranks 17th of 121 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$), per capita in Kazakhstan, year by year

Annual values for External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$), per capita in Kazakhstan, 1992 to 2024.
Year DOD, current US$ per person Change
1992 0.5325 DOD, current US$ per person
1993 1.25 DOD, current US$ per person +135.1%
1994 13.63 DOD, current US$ per person +989.0%
1995 22.8 DOD, current US$ per person +67.2%
1996 13.48 DOD, current US$ per person -40.9%
1997 21.75 DOD, current US$ per person +61.4%
1998 27.09 DOD, current US$ per person +24.5%
1999 30.67 DOD, current US$ per person +13.3%
2000 62 DOD, current US$ per person +102.1%
2001 86.16 DOD, current US$ per person +39.0%
2002 117.65 DOD, current US$ per person +36.5%
2003 178.63 DOD, current US$ per person +51.8%
2004 248.75 DOD, current US$ per person +39.3%
2005 507.41 DOD, current US$ per person +104.0%
2006 772.82 DOD, current US$ per person +52.3%
2007 709.21 DOD, current US$ per person -8.2%
2008 577.53 DOD, current US$ per person -18.6%
2009 420.29 DOD, current US$ per person -27.2%
2010 526.5 DOD, current US$ per person +25.3%
2011 513.04 DOD, current US$ per person -2.6%
2012 525.04 DOD, current US$ per person +2.3%
2013 540.92 DOD, current US$ per person +3.0%
2014 548.99 DOD, current US$ per person +1.5%
2015 346.18 DOD, current US$ per person -36.9%
2016 366.62 DOD, current US$ per person +5.9%
2017 411.67 DOD, current US$ per person +12.3%
2018 441.87 DOD, current US$ per person +7.3%
2019 469.66 DOD, current US$ per person +6.3%
2020 488.44 DOD, current US$ per person +4.0%
2021 610.72 DOD, current US$ per person +25.0%
2022 817.8 DOD, current US$ per person +33.9%
2023 953.03 DOD, current US$ per person +16.5%
2024 951.53 DOD, current US$ per person -0.2%

How this figure is calculated

External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$) ÷ Population, total

Computed from

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
